Method
For the Catfish
Prepare the Coating
In a shallow dish, combine cornmeal, flour, cayenne pepper, paprika, garlic powder, salt, and black pepper. Mix well.
Soak the Catfish
Place the catfish fillets in a separate shallow dish and pour buttermilk over them, ensuring they are thoroughly coated. Let them soak for about 15 minutes.
Coat the Fillets
After soaking, remove the fillets from the buttermilk and let excess liquid drip off. Dredge each fillet in the cornmeal mixture, pressing gently to adhere the coating.
Fry the Catfish
In a large skillet, heat vegetable oil over medium-high heat. Once hot, carefully add the coated catfish fillets. Fry for 3-4 minutes on each side or until golden brown and cooked through. Remove and drain on paper towels.
